Rice Production in Indonesia - Bali

Rice Production in Indonesia - Bali

Farmers lift and position sacks of harvested rice beside a road near a paddy field in Denpasar, Bali, Indonesia on September 14, 2023. The sacks are prepared for inspection, weighing and sale to a broker before being loaded onto a truck. Photo by Nicola Longobardi/Middle East Images/ABACAPRESS.COm

Darougheh Historical House - Iran

Darougheh Historical House - Iran

A view of the courtyard and balcony of Darougheh House in Mashhad, Iran, on September 27, 2023. The historic Darougheh House was built in the late Qajar era by order of Yousef Khan Herati, the last darougheh (warden) of Mashhad. It covers approximately 1,100 square meters. Until the 1980s, the heirs of the late Herati resided in this house. Photo by Morteza Aminoroayayi/Middle East Images/ABACAPRESS.COM
